Prevention of HIV-1 Infection with Early Antiretroviral Therapy
Source: View publication →
In HIV-1 serodiscordant couples, early initiation of antiretroviral therapy by the infected partner reduced the risk of linked sexual transmission by 96%.

Clinical Significance
The HPTN 052 trial definitively proved the concept of 'Treatment as Prevention' (TasP). By demonstrating that viral suppression essentially eliminates the risk of sexual transmission, the study prompted major shifts in global health policies, leading the WHO to eventually recommend ART for all people living with HIV regardless of CD4 count. It also provided the foundational evidence for the global 'Undetectable = Untransmittable' (U=U) campaign.
Historical Context
Prior to 2011, antiretroviral therapy was primarily viewed as a tool for managing individual patient health and was frequently delayed until CD4 counts dropped below certain thresholds (e.g., <200 or <350 cells/mm³) to mitigate drug toxicity and resistance risks. While observational data suggested that ART could reduce transmission, public health guidelines required randomized trial data to validate TasP. The results of HPTN 052 were hailed as the 'Breakthrough of the Year' by Science in 2011 and radically reshaped the trajectory of the global HIV response.

How does early initiation of antiretroviral therapy (ART) in an HIV-1 infected individual biologically reduce the risk of sexual transmission to a seronegative partner, and which specific laboratory marker is the primary surrogate for this reduced infectivity?
Key Response
ART inhibits viral replication, significantly reducing HIV RNA levels in blood and genital secretions. A suppressed viral load (e.g., undetectable or under 200 copies/mL) correlates directly with the inability to transmit the virus sexually, a foundational biological concept now widely recognized as U=U (Undetectable = Untransmittable).
A serodiscordant couple presents to your clinic; the HIV-positive partner was just diagnosed with a CD4 count of 450 cells/mm3. Based on the findings of this study, how should you counsel them regarding the initiation of ART and the need for additional preventive measures like PrEP for the negative partner?
Key Response
Based on HPTN 052, the positive partner should start ART immediately, regardless of CD4 count, to prevent transmission (96% risk reduction) and improve their own health. The resident should counsel that while waiting for the positive partner's viral load to become fully suppressed (which can take up to 6 months), the negative partner could be offered PrEP and they should continue using barrier protection.
In this study, the efficacy endpoint was based specifically on 'linked' HIV-1 transmissions. How is linkage determined in such trials, and why is this distinction critical when evaluating the true efficacy of ART as prevention in serodiscordant couples?
Key Response
Linkage is determined using phylogenetic analysis of the HIV-1 env and pol gene sequences from both partners to ensure the virus in the newly infected partner originated directly from the index partner. Without distinguishing linked from unlinked transmissions (infections acquired from outside the partnership), the true biological efficacy of Treatment as Prevention (TasP) within the couple would be significantly underestimated.
HPTN 052 was a major catalyst for shifting global HIV management from CD4-stratified treatment to a universal 'test and treat' approach. How does this paradigm shift balance individual clinical benefit against public health transmission control, and what are the primary operational barriers to achieving the population-level impact demonstrated in this controlled trial?
Key Response
Early ART provides dual benefits: preserving individual immune function (reducing opportunistic infections and non-AIDS events) and halting population transmission. However, achieving trial-level efficacy in the real world requires overcoming the 'HIV care cascade' barriers: testing access, rapid linkage to care, long-term retention, and lifelong adherence to achieve sustained virologic suppression.

The Data and Safety Monitoring Board (DSMB) stopped the HPTN 052 trial early due to overwhelming efficacy. What are the methodological risks of halting a prevention trial early for efficacy, particularly regarding the estimation of long-term durability, behavioral risk compensation, and adverse event profiles?
Key Response
Stopping early for efficacy can lead to an overestimation of the treatment effect (a 'random high') and truncates long-term follow-up. This limits the ability of researchers to observe long-term ART toxicity, virologic failure rates over time, and potential 'risk compensation' (e.g., decreased condom use) that might alter the long-term effectiveness of the intervention in real-world settings.
As a peer reviewer assessing the generalizability of these findings, how does the demographic composition of the study cohort (e.g., 97% heterosexual couples) affect the validity of extrapolating the 96% reduction in transmission risk to men who have sex with men (MSM) or people who inject drugs (PWID)?
Key Response
The transmission probability per act varies significantly by route, with receptive anal intercourse being much higher risk than vaginal intercourse. A critical reviewer would flag that while biological suppression is universal, the absolute efficacy and required adherence thresholds for TasP might differ in MSM or PWID, necessitating subsequent studies like PARTNER and Opposites Attract to confirm U=U across all populations.
How did the results of HPTN 052 influence the strength of recommendation and level of evidence for ART initiation in DHHS and WHO guidelines, and how does this study's focus on transmission risk harmonize with subsequent data (like the START trial) regarding individual morbidity?
Key Response
HPTN 052 provided Grade 1A evidence for ART to prevent transmission, prompting guidelines to recommend ART for all HIV-positive individuals with serodiscordant partners regardless of CD4 count. When later combined with the START trial (which proved individual health benefits of early ART), guidelines universally shifted to recommend ART for all people living with HIV, establishing the current 'Treat All' era.

Noteworthy Related Trials
START Trial
Tested
Immediate initiation of ART
Population
HIV-positive adults with CD4+ count > 500 cells/mm3
Comparator
Deferred initiation of ART until CD4+ declined to 350 cells/mm3
Endpoint
Composite of serious AIDS-related events, serious non-AIDS-related events, or death
PROUD Trial
Tested
Daily oral TDF-FTC (PrEP)
Population
HIV-negative men who have sex with men at high risk of infection
Comparator
Deferred PrEP initiation (after 12 months)
Endpoint
Incidence of HIV infection
PARTNER Trial
Tested
Suppressive ART in the HIV-positive partner
Population
Serodiscordant couples engaging in condomless sex
Comparator
Observational cohort (no control)
Endpoint
Phylogenetically linked HIV transmission
